I started this motorized bike thing about two months ago and I think I've gotten a little carried lol.The huffy cranbrook was the first one and it's now my wifes.The orange moondog was built a couple of weeks later for a friend,and then the blue moondog is mine.They all have 80cc boy go fast kits and so far are running great.The jesse james is my latest project that I hope to have going before to long.It has the tail section,rear fender and wheels off of,you guessed it ,a stingray.The springer fork is not functional but it sure looks cool.I'll keep you posted on it's progress.THANKS for looking and tell me what you think.
